M-P’s Meetsma stands out at swim meet

MARYSVILLE – Ian Meetsma stood out for the Marysville—Pilchuck/Marysville Getchell high school boys swim team against Snohomish and Glacier Peak Tuesday.

In the 200-yard medley relay, M-P was second with Meetsma, Leif Anderson, Jared Edge and Jake Howat. Their time was 1 minute, 56.19 seconds, just 2/10ths of a second faster than Snohomish.

Meetsma later placed second in the 100 freestyle, with a clocking of 55.82 seconds. He also placed second in the 100 backstroke with a time of 1:05.95.

Finally, Meetsma was part of M-P’s 200 free relay team that finished third in 1:43.16. Also on that team were Howat, Edge and Nate Novy. MG was fifth in that race in 1:56.86. On that squad were Lauren Vital, Hunter Brown, Nicholas Carlson and Kameron Wilkes.

MG’s 400 free relay team was third in 4:04.26. On that squad were Carson St. John, Caleb Pearson, Jawan Smith and Kameron Wilkes. M-P was fifth in 4:16.95 with Howat, Edge, Novy and Wyatt Yarbrough.

Anderson placed fourth in the 1-meter diving competition, scoring 159.4 points.

Novy finished in fifth place for M-P in the 100 butterfly.

Ethan Nelson was fifth in the 500 free with a clocking of 6:40.2.

In the 200 free, Wilkes was the top local finisher, placing sixth in 2:20.38.

In the 200 IM, Carlson placed sixth for MG in 2:52.02.

Jesse Nahinu of MG was sixth in the 50 free with a time of 26.39 seconds.

And in the 100 breaststroke, Carson Mielke of MG was sixth, finishing in 1:33.66.
